Objective Socialization - It refers to the society acting upon the individual 2. If your student is engaging in aggressive behavior 20 times a day, even though it is desired, it is not realistic to write that they will eliminate 100% of aggressive behavior. In a situation like this, you might think about reducing (rather than eliminating) either the frequency, duration, or intensity of the particular behavior. ), In addition, this level of specificity ensures consistency across settings.
